## Partitioning

Orvane's events table is partitioned by month. Support: queries without a date range scan every partition and will time out — always ask customers for a month window first. Partitions older than eighteen months are archived automatically. Archive exports are signed before delivery, and the key used for those exports appears below.

release key, fajef-kajeg: bky19_LdLu6Ne6FLi8he2c24d

**CI note: timezone weirdness in report exports**

Heads up, support folks — if a customer says their Ledgerpine export shows times shifted by a few hours, it's probably the CI image. The export workers got rebuilt last week and the base image defaults to UTC, while older workers used the account's locale. Fix is rolling out; meanwhile tell customers the data itself is fine, just the display offset. Affected exports carry the build token shown below.

build token for bajof-tahop: htk4_a981

Action item from the Gearbine build outage: we're adding NTP enforcement on all build agents after clock skew caused signed plugin artifacts to fail validation. Plugin authors, heads up — timestamps more than 90 seconds off will now be rejected at upload. Nothing changes in your tooling, just keep your clocks sane. Details and the new validation policy are posted here:

runbook for badug-kadup: https://confluence.zemvarlabs.internal/projects/browse/display/projects/bd1b